Position Overview

We are seeking a dynamic and motivated individual to join our team as an Operations Specialist, where you will be working in our warehouse department. As an Operations Specialist you will support our customers by providing accurate and timely fulfillment of orders involving IoT connectivity devices. This role is responsible for kitting, packing, inventory tracking, and quality assurance in a structured, process-driven environment. You will ensure the delivery of error-free, deployment-ready hardware through strict adherence to our established workflows.


You will be responsible for a wide range of tasks:

  

  • Pick, kit, and package IoT devices and related components for shipment with complete accuracy.
  • Follow all documented standard operating procedures (SOPs) for fulfillment and packaging without deviation.
  • Complete deployment process for IoT devices including but not limited to: quality assurance of hardware, device activation, load and test customer’s software profile.
  • Maintain inventory levels for both stocked items and deployment-ready devices; assist in cycle counts and reconciliation.
  • Input and verify inventory data in warehouse systems (e.g., WMS or ERP).
  • Identify and escalate discrepancies or quality concerns to operations leadership.
  • Ensure all packages are labeled, sealed, and shipped to the correct locations in accordance with shipping protocols.
  • Contribute to continuous process reliability by upholding organizational and cleanliness standards.
  • Help with any other tasks as needed around the warehouse.
